Fulfilled by TikTok (FBT) is TikTok Shop's in-house service that handles storage, packing, and shipping for merchants. Fulfilled by TikTok (FBT) team is seeking an experienced Seller Growth Manager to join our team. The successful candidate will be responsible for recruiting new sellers to the FBT platform and driving increased usage across our existing seller portfolio. This role requires a strategic thinker with a strong track record in business development and sales, a deep understanding of e-commerce, and the ability to build and maintain strong relationships with sellers.

The Elections Division plays a critical role in ensuring Washington's democratic process is fair, accurate, accessible, and secure. Elections staff provide valuable services to voters, as well as statutorily required training and certifications to election administrators in all 39 counties. The division develops elections policy, administers our statewide voter registration database, manages statewide elections, and verifies and accepts petitions for initiatives and referenda.
VoteWA Support Manager, WMS2
Full-time, Permanent
The VoteWA Support Manager is a member of the Elections Management Team that advises the Elections Deputy Director and Director on direction and policy, which helps set strategic direction for the division. This position reports to the Elections Deputy Director. This position is deemed critical or essential according to the Division's Continuity of Operations Plan (COOP) as the Division would heavily rely on this work unit to support VoteWA activities and functions.
This position reports to the Deputy Director of Elections and is responsible for managing the VoteWA support team. VoteWA is a mission critical application required to register voters and conduct elections statewide. The VoteWA support manager develops, implements, and manages program objectives and priorities. Much of this work is accomplished in collaboration with external stakeholders and 39 independently elected auditors and election officials.
The VoteWA program manager is responsible for making collaborative strategic judgements and decisions balancing competing program demands and priorities for resources. This position plays a critical leadership role within the Elections Division of the Office of the Secretary of State (OSOS), overseeing the VoteWA Support Team and ensuring effective collaboration between state and county election officials. The incumbent is responsible for supervising staff, managing the delivery of high-quality customer service, and ensuring the functionality and usability of VoteWA-the centralized voter registration and election management system mandated under RCW 29A.08.125.
The position leads the development and implementation of the VoteWA training program and user manual for county election administrators, ensuring compliance with Washington State election laws and promoting consistent, accurate election administration across all 39 counties. A key responsibility includes managing the end-to-end process for Initiative and Referendum (I&R) filings in accordance with RCW 29A.72, ensuring legal compliance, transparency, and timely communication with stakeholders.
Additionally, the position serves as the primary conduit for VoteWA-related communication between OSOS and county election offices. This includes representing OSOS in advisory and user engagement groups, gathering and synthesizing feedback from county users, and providing actionable recommendations to leadership and the VoteWA development team. The role requires a deep understanding of Washington's election laws, strong leadership and communication skills, and a commitment to supporting secure, accessible, and transparent elections statewide.
